Up to date and easy to read, this textbook provides comprehensive coverage of all major concepts of health promotion and disease prevention. It highlights growth and development throughout the life span, emphasizing normal development as well as the specific problems and health promotion issues common to each stage. All population groups are addressed with separate chapters for individuals, families, and communities. -- Provided by publisher.

Promote health and wellness for all ages and population groups! Health Promotion Throughout the Life Span, 9th Edition provides a comprehensive guide to leading health promotion concepts, from assessment to interventions to application. Its lifespan approach addresses patients' unique needs with case studies and care plans, with an assessment framework based on Gordon's Functional Health Patterns. New to this edition is expanded coverage of genomics and QSEN competencies. Written by nursing experts Carole Edelman and Elizabeth Kudzma, this bestselling text covers all the latest research and trends in health promotion and disease prevention. - Separate chapters on population groups — the individual, family, and community — highlight the unique aspects of assessment and health promotion for each group. - Coverage of growth and development helps you apply health promotion concepts to each age and each stage of development through the lifespan. - Case studies present realistic situations with questions asking you to apply key concepts, and care plans include nursing diagnoses, defining characteristics, related factors, expected outcomes, and interventions. - Quality and Safety Scenario boxes focus on QSEN-related competencies with examples of health promotion. - Innovative Practice boxes outline unique and creative health promotion programs and projects currently being implemented. - Healthy People 2020 boxes present goals and objectives relating to national health issues and priorities. - Research for Evidence-Based Practice boxes summarize current health-promotion studies showing the links between research, theory, and practice. - Diversity Awareness boxes address cultural perspectives relating to planning care. - Hot Topics boxes introduce significant issues, trends, and controversies in health promotion. - Think About It clinical scenarios open each chapter, and include questions to encourage critical thinking. - NEW! An increased focus on genomics reflects scientific evidence supporting the use of genetic tests and family health history to guide public health interventions. - NEW! Expanded discussion of QSEN competencies is included, as related to health promotion. - NEW! Guidelines and recommendations are included from the latest Guide to Clinical Preventive Services from the U.S. Preventive Services Task Force. - NEW! The latest information about the Affordable Care Act is included. - NEW! Updated photos reflect the latest in health promotion and disease prevention.

Master health promotion for all ages and population groups! Edelman's Health Promotion Throughout the Life Span, 11th Edition, provides comprehensive coverage of leading health promotion concepts, from assessment to interventions to application. Its lifespan approach addresses patients' unique needs with case studies and care plans presented within an assessment framework based on Gordon's Functional Health Patterns. Addressing each age and stage of development, this market-leading text covers the latest research and trends in health promotion and disease prevention for diverse population groups. NEW! Greater emphasis on social determinants of health (SDOH) explores this key topic in public health nursing NEW! Completely revised chapters reflect the most current practice from experts in the field NEW! Content explores increased health inequity in the US, the evolving global health outcomes as a result of COVID, and increased involvement of at-risk communities NEW! Evidence addresses healthcare decisions, as well as maintaining the health and wellbeing of healthcare professionals NEW! Updated photos and graphics freshen the view and visually reinforce essential content NEW! Updated language reflects the NCSBN Clinical Judgment Measurement Model to align with the Next-Generation NCLEX® exam Separate chapters on population groups - the individual, family, and community - highlight the unique aspects of assessment and health promotion for each group Coverage of growth and development helps apply health promotion concepts to each age and each stage of development through the lifespan Case studies present realistic situations with questions asking you to apply key concepts to further develop clinical judgment Care plans include patient problems, defining characteristics, related factors, expected outcomes, and interventions Quality and Safety Scenario boxes focus on QSEN-related competencies with examples of health promotion Innovative Practice boxes outline unique and creative health promotion programs and projects currently being implemented Healthy People boxes present goals and objectives relating to national health issues and priorities Research for Evidence-Based Practice boxes summarize current health-promotion studies showing the links between research, theory, and practice Diversity Awareness boxes address cultural perspectives relating to planning care. Hot Topics boxes introduce significant issues, trends, and controversies in health promotion Think About It clinical scenarios open each chapter and include questions to encourage clinical judgment
